With a mighty leap, a soul enters the afterlife, as imagined by artist Heidi Taillefer. Silkworm explores the dualities of life and death, light and dark, nature and technology. The ethereal work—a reverie that diffuses elements of varied world religions, mythologies, and cultures, as so much of Taillefer’s figurative surrealist art does—grounds itself through its details, from the finely wrought tracery inspired by Indonesian shadow puppets to its title, an allusion to an Eastern folktale. Here, Taillefer’s white birds not only carry messages of peace and protection, freedom and hope, they also usher the spirit on to whatever lies next.
